Output 63662e528f958695c98d5211294206ed4c509a6f0983d71604633ceda504c724:1

value
2526933
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a02e6b55b535e34b9c7063887ce022dc186a24ae OP_EQUAL
address
3GHyeWDPKa1naqrr2BwRaGJ6HM3qsVDUuX
transaction
63662e528f958695c98d5211294206ed4c509a6f0983d71604633ceda504c724